Step 2: Verify Your Email Address

Open your inbox and look for an email from [email protected] titled "Verify Your Email Address."

Click the verification link inside the email. This will redirect you back to Coinbase’s site.

You’ll need to log in again using your newly created email and password to complete the email verification process.

Once confirmed, you can proceed to the next step: phone verification.


Step 3: Verify Your Phone Number

Two-factor authentication (2FA) via SMS adds an essential layer of security.

Here’s how to complete it:

  1. Sign in to your Coinbase account.
  2. When prompted, select your country code.
  3. Enter your mobile number.
  4. Click Send Code (desktop) or tap Continue (mobile).
  5. Check your phone for a 7-digit verification code sent via SMS.
  6. Enter the code on the verification screen.
  7. Click Submit or tap Continue.

If you don’t receive the code, choose Resend SMS.

🔒 Pro Tip: After setup, consider enabling a 2-step verification app (TOTP) like Google Authenticator for stronger protection against unauthorized access.

Step 5: Verify Your Identity

To unlock full functionality—like buying, selling, and transferring crypto—you must complete identity verification.

Here’s what to expect:

  1. Log in to your account.
  2. Follow prompts to upload a clear photo of your photo ID (driver’s license, passport, or state ID).
  3. Take a live selfie for facial recognition matching.
  4. Wait for approval—typically within 24 hours, though some cases may take longer.

Once verified, you’ll gain access to all core trading features.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Is creating a Coinbase account free?

Yes. There is no cost to sign up or maintain a Coinbase account. Fees only apply when you trade or withdraw crypto.

Q: Can I use Coinbase without verifying my identity?

You can create an account without immediate verification, but you won’t be able to buy or sell crypto until the process is complete.

Q: Why does Coinbase need my SSN?

For U.S. users, Coinbase collects the last four digits of your SSN for identity verification and regulatory compliance, similar to traditional financial institutions.

Q: What should I do if I don’t receive the SMS code?

Ensure your phone number is entered correctly. Try resending the code or contact Coinbase support if issues persist.

Q: Can I change my email address after registration?

Yes, but only after verifying your current email. You can update it under Account Settings once logged in.

Q: How long does identity verification take?

Most users are verified within 24 hours, but delays may occur during high traffic or if documents are unclear.
